Industrial Vacuum for Car Wash: Addressing Modern Cleaning Challenges

The global vehicle service equipment market is projected to reach $9.7 billion by 2029 (MarketsandMarkets, 2023), with industrial vacuum systems driving 23% of this growth. Automotive service centers now process 40-60 vehicles daily, requiring vacuums that deliver 120-150 CFM airflow and withstand 10+ hours of continuous operation. Unlike residential units, industrial vacuum cleaners for car wash facilities utilize triple-stage filtration capturing 99.97% of particulates below 0.3 microns.

Engineering Superiority in Debris Management Systems

Leading models feature:

  • 15 HP motors generating 98" water lift
  • 30-gallon stainless steel debris tanks
  • Thermally protected windings (up to 356°F tolerance)

Cyclone separation technology reduces filter maintenance by 70% compared to traditional bag systems. Noise levels remain below 78 dB even at peak performance, complying with OSHA workplace standards.

Configuring Site-Specific Solutions

Modular designs allow:

  • Dual-voltage operation (120V/240V)
  • Expandable 40-60 gal tank arrays
  • Retractable cord reels (50-100 ft options)

High-volume operators often combine central vacuum systems with portable units, achieving 85% faster bay turnover rates. Water-separator attachments prevent 92% of liquid-related motor failures in wash bays.

Q: What is an industrial vacuum for car wash used for?

A: An industrial vacuum for car wash is designed to efficiently remove dirt, debris, and moisture from vehicle interiors. It offers high suction power and large debris capacity for commercial car wash settings. These systems are built to withstand frequent, heavy-duty use.

Q: How does an industrial car wash vacuum differ from regular vacuums?

A: Industrial car wash vacuums feature robust motors, larger dustbins, and specialized attachments for deep cleaning carpets and upholstery. They are water-resistant and designed for continuous operation, unlike standard household vacuums.

Q: What should I look for in an industrial vacuum cleaner for car wash facilities?

A: Prioritize high suction power (≥100 CFM), durable construction, and HEPA filtration to trap allergens. Look for features like automatic shut-off, moisture-separating technology, and compatibility with car wash environments.

Q: Can industrial vacuums for car washes handle wet and dry debris?

A: Yes, most industrial car wash vacuums are dual-purpose, equipped to handle both wet spills and dry dirt. They include moisture-separating tanks and corrosion-resistant components for safe liquid suction.

Q: Why choose an industrial-grade vacuum over consumer models for car washes?

A: Industrial vacuums provide 3-5x longer lifespan, faster cleaning cycles, and commercial warranties. They meet safety standards for wet environments and reduce downtime with heavy-duty components.
